Não consigo executar a unidade 3d no meu Chromebook, mas a unidade 2d no Ubuntu 12.04 funciona bem, por isso é possível executar o modo de baixa unidade gráfica no Ubuntu 14.04 como uma alternativa? Se eu puder executar o modo de gráficos baixos como uma alternativa, como eu faria isso? Se eu não puder, então o que seria uma boa unidade como alternativa para o Ubuntu 14.04?
Eu testei esses DE no Ubuntu 14.04 no meu Chromebook:
- LXDE: funciona bem
- XFCE: funciona bem
- Gnome: não funciona de todo
- Unity: não funciona de todo
- KDE: Ainda não testei este DE
Estou usando o crouton para instalar a unidade e, de acordo com o (s) criador (es) deste script, dizer que a unidade 3d não funcionará para mim, pois exige uma aceleração de hardware que meu Chromebook não oferece.
O que acontece quando eu executo o unity 3d é uma tela preta / cinza seguida por um bloqueio completo do Ubuntu que eu preciso encerrar no crosh (o console de desenvolvedores do Chromebooks no qual o Ubuntu está sendo executado).
Este é o script de destino modificado que estou usando com crouton para instalar o unity 3d no samsung arm chromebook (observe que ainda não está totalmente funcional).
#!/bin/sh -e
# Copyright (c) 2014 The crouton Authors. All rights reserved.
# Use of this source code is governed by a BSD-style license that can be
# found in the LICENSE file.
REQUIRES='gtk-extra'
DESCRIPTION='Installs the Unity desktop environment. (Approx. 700MB)'
HOSTBIN='startunity'
CHROOTBIN='startunity gnome-session-wrapper crouton-unity-autostart'
CHROOTETC='unity-autostart.desktop unity-profiled'
. "${TARGETSDIR:="$PWD"}/common"
### Append to prepare.sh:
install ubuntu-desktop ubuntu-artwork gnome-session nautilus \
ubuntu-settings,ubuntu~precise= \
ubuntu-session,ubuntu~precise+ubuntu~quantal+ubuntu~raring+ubuntu~saucy+ubuntu~trusty= \
-- network-manager
# XDG autostart/profile.d additions only needed in saucy and later
if release -ge saucy; then
autostartdir='/etc/xdg/autostart'
# Remove previous indicator-only desktop file
rm -f "$autostartdir"/crouton-unity-indicator.desktop
# Set up global autostart script
mkdir -p "$autostartdir"
ln -sfT /etc/crouton/unity-autostart.desktop \
"$autostartdir"/crouton-unity-autostart.desktop
# Set up profile.d
chmod 755 /etc/crouton/unity-profiled
ln -sfT /etc/crouton/unity-profiled /etc/profile.d/crouton-unity-profiled.sh
fi
if release -ge trusty; then
autostartdir='/etc/xdg/autostart'
# Remove previous indicator-only desktop file
rm -f "$autostartdir"/crouton-unity-indicator.desktop
# Set up global autostart script
mkdir -p "$autostartdir"
ln -sfT /etc/crouton/unity-autostart.desktop \
"$autostartdir"/crouton-unity-autostart.desktop
# Set up profile.d
chmod 755 /etc/crouton/unity-profiled
ln -sfT /etc/crouton/unity-profiled /etc/profile.d/crouton-unity-profiled.sh
fi
TIPS="$TIPS
You can start Unity via the startunity host command: sudo startunity
"
O problema atual com este script é que eu preciso implementar o modo de baixo gráfico unitário diretamente nele na instalação e não consigo descobrir como fazer isso.
Se você quiser testar o script com crouton, siga estas etapas:
Guarde o script como um arquivo sem extensão sob o nome "unitylowg" no diretório Downloads do Chrome OS.
Depois, encontre suas dependências executando esses scripts, um por um:
sudo sh -e ~/Downloads/crouton -t core -r trusty
sudo sh -e ~/Downloads/crouton -t audio -r trusty -u
sudo sh -e ~/Downloads/crouton -t xephyr -r trusty -u
sudo sh -e ~/Downloads/crouton -t x11 -r trusty -u
sudo sh -e ~/Downloads/crouton -t gtk-extra -r trusty -u
Então, finalmente, execute o script com o seguinte:
sudo sh -e ~/Downloads/crouton -T ~/Downloads/unitylowg -r trusty -u